Engine varnish?? Pretty normal really 850 1995

You'll see that stuff on almost ANY engine that uses normal petroleum based oils. In itself, that won't be the demise of your engine.
Now, the cleanest engine looking components I've ever seen on dismatelled engines came from engines that used Amsoil (dismantelled for reasons not related to oil either btw, like a bad head gasket, not a Volvo). I now use Amsoil in my cars.
I see that varnish in most engines but other than coloring the parts, I can't say that it's the reason why any engine might have oil related problems in later life, assuming that oil is changed as often as need be.
So, don't worry about it.
